Kris Boyd makes Rangers, Celtic title prediction after CL humiliation

Kris Boyd has given his verdict on the Scottish Premiership title race between Rangers and Celtic after the latter lost 7-1 to Borussia Dortmund in the Champions League.

Speaking on Sky Sports News (2 October, 10:04am), Boyd said that despite their humiliation on the continent by Dortmund, he still thinks Celtic will beat Rangers to the league title.

Acknowledging that the Gers’ Old Firm rivals are also favourites in both of Scotland’s domestic cup competitions, Boyd did say that Tuesday’s (1 October) heavy loss could have been even worse for Celtic.

He said: “[Celtic] will still win the league. They’re the favourites to win both cups as well.

“But once again, despite being very optimistic, last night’s performance brought them right back down to reality – it could easily have been a lot more [than seven goals].”

Rangers must take advantage of Celtic’s European humiliation

Regardless of which way one leans on the Old Firm scales, it’s almost impressive to see a side win their European opener 5-1 and still end up with a negative goal difference 90 minutes of football later.

Philippe Clement’s Gers also got off to a winning start in their European campaign, recording an impressive 2-0 win at Malmo, but will be wary of repeating Celtic’s woes this time around.

The Light Blues host Lyon on 3 October in their next Europa League match, with Clement hoping that a raucous Ibrox atmosphere can help his side make it two wins from two on the continent.

Their 2-0 victory in Malmo was the third of four wins and clean sheets in a row across all competitions, and if the Gers want to close the five-point gap on Celtic in the Premiership, this form must continue.

Celtic’s defeat in Dortmund will leave other Scottish sides smelling blood and looking to take advantage of their evident vulnerabilities, and no side will be more keen to exploit those weaknesses than Rangers.
